Understanding Mental Illness in Clarkson, KY
Any condition that negatively affects our psychological well-being can be considered a mental illness. Because all of our self-worth and communications are dependent on our mental health, it is detrimental that we take care of Mental Illness when we become aware of it. If someone cannot process their thoughts and emotions effectively, they can soon feel alienated and struggle with self-esteem. Sadly, it is also common for individuals to turn to Drugs & Alcohol to self-medicate. As a result, a person's mental Illness can go untreated for years—resulting in a much more dire situation. When this happens, the best route of treatment is likely a Dual Diagnosis facility. Dual diagnosis treatment is designed to allow both diseases to be treated at the same time.
How to Pick a Mental Health Care Provider in Clarkson, KY
When choosing a mental health provider in Clarkson, KY , the most critical factor is to accurately consider the individual's needs. Typically, we recommend beginning with what you already knowz, because denial is a common side effect. It is best to start by identifying the individual’s current mental health status and if they are consuming any types of mind altering substances. Suppose drug are present, then selecting a dual diagnosis facility to treat the co-occurring disorders would be recommended. Once a decision has been made on the type of facility to attend, a clinical assessment by the provider is the next step. Almost all rehabs will have a an in-depth and intensive evaluation. This will help the facility affirm that the person is an ideal fit for their treatment program. Another reasn for the assessment is to help provide the clinical stall with insight on the individual needs of the patient.

Paying for Clarkson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is an overview of all of the possible ways to pay for mental health treatment:
- Private Insurance may be available through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through an online marketplace to those who earn less than a certain income, but also do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Cash Pay]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health treatment Clarkson out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Occasionally, mental health rehabilitation facilities Clarkson offer scholarship opportunities for individuals who exhibit a tremendous yearning and commitment to healing, but do not have the treatment.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health treatment to lower income individuals in their community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with a great demand for these services.
